你查询的IP:[168.160.76.40]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询119.8.23.212 125.98.65.111 117.44.61.71 219.244.51.17 114.80.181.92 118.242.35.90 122.64.98.140 61.236.58.206 203.94.25.223 168.160.76.40 220.160.85.182 122.144.128.55 203.207.128.39 202.160.176.68 123.242.53.28 125.98.91.185 202.136.48.221 123.136.80.56 123.49.128.126 118.67.112.67 116.52.249.65 123.180.221.71 118.124.101.54 125.210.27.162 203.93.243.201 124.108.40.56 119.20.184.84 203.174.7.20 60.252.137.241 124.147.128.193 121.76.3.247